This Ionisation Smoke Detector comes with a molded self-extinguishing white polycarbonate case having wind resistant smoke inlets. There are stainless Steel wiper contacts that connect the Ionisation Smoke Detector to the terminals in the mounting base. Inside the Ionisation Smoke Detector case there is a printed circuit board that has the ionization chamber mounted on a side and the signal processing, address capture and communications electronics on the other. The ionization chamber system is an inner reference chamber which lies inside an outer smoke chamber. The outer smoke chamber is equipped with smoke inlet apertures fitted with an insect resistant mesh. There is radioactive source holder and the outer smoke chamber that are the positive and negative electrodes respectively. An americium 241 radioactive source mounted within the inner reference chamber irradiates the air in both chambers to produce positive and negative ions. On applying a voltage across these electrodes an electric field is formed. The ions are attracted to the electrode of the opposite sign, some ions collide and recombine, but the final result is that a small electric current flows between the two electrodes.

This Multisensor Smoke Detector contains an optical smoke sensor and a thermistor temperature sensor that has its outputs combined to give the final analogue value. The multisensor construction is similar to the optical detector but uses a different lid and optical moldings to house the thermistor temperature sensor. The sectional view (below) reflects the arrangement of the optical chamber and thermistor. The signals from the optical smoke sensing element and the temperature sensor are independent, and represent the smoke level and the air temperature respectively in the vicinity of the detector. The detectors microcontroller processes the two signals. The temperature signal processing extracts only rate of rise information for combination with the optical signal. The detector will not respond to a slow temperature increase, even if the temperature reaches higher level. An abrupt change in temperature can, however, cause an alarm without the presence of smoke, if sustained for 20 seconds.

Our Temperature Smoke Detectors have a common profile with ionization and optical smoke detectors but have a low air flow resistance case made of self-extinguishing white polycarbonate. They monitor temperature by using a single thermistor network which provides a voltage output proportional to the external air temperature. FunctioningThe response to temperature increases of the standard temperature detector (part no: 55000-400IMC) enables the detector to be utilized as an EN54 Grade 2 heat detector. To provide a device for use in ambient temperatures of up to 50oC, a high temperature detector (part no: 55000-401IMC) is also available. This has similar characteristics to the standard temperature detector at 25oC but reaches a 55 count (alarm) at 90oC.

In our Stand Alone Smoke Detector (CFR-SD-DT) ionization is more sensitive at detecting small particles, which are likely to be produced in greater amounts by flaming fires. Photoelectric is more sensitive at detecting large particles, which can be produced in large amounts by smoldering fires.
